public virtual Employee CreateEmployee(string myName, string userName, string emailAddress, Currency currency) {
     var emp = Container.NewTransientInstance<Employee>();
     emp.Name = myName;
     emp.UserName = userName;
     emp.EmailAddress = emailAddress;
     emp.Currency = currency;
     Container.Persist(ref emp);
     return emp;
 }
 public void Install() {
     EUR = CreateCurrency("EUR", "Euro Member Countries", "Euro");
     GBP = CreateCurrency("GBP", "United Kingdom", "Pounds");
     USD = CreateCurrency("USD", "United States of America", "Dollars");
 }
 public void ChangeCurrency(Currency newCurrency) {
     Employee.Currency = newCurrency;
 }